Mobility Devices that can be transported

When you must travel by car, bus, plane, or train, mobility devices that can be moved can allow you to travel wherever you wish to go. You can pick a device that fits inside the trunk of your car and folds away for 1559014.xyz (1559014.xyz) storage when not in use, or can be disassembled to allow it to fit into the overhead compartment of an plane.

These models can be very useful when traveling over long distances as well as for travel to local shops hotels, museums, or vacation destinations. They are lightweight making them easy to carry and lift by a single person.

Verify with the airline prior making a booking to confirm that your mobility device is accepted. Certain airlines permit you to bring a scooter in your carry-on luggage, while others require you to verify it with them.

The size and weight of a device can have a big impact on how easily a mobility device is transported. It can also affect its speed and incline range, as well as its the maximum lifting height. To avoid these issues, it is recommended to search for an item that weighs as light as possible without sacrificing durability or security.

Another aspect to consider is the ground clearance of the mobility scooter. If you intend to drive your scooter through rough terrain like grass, dirt or gravel, a good ground clearance is vital. Certain models have a minimum of 1.5 inches of clearance from the ground, while others offer up to five inches of clearance.

You must also take into consideration the turning radius and maneuverability of the mobility scooter. This is especially important when the mobility device is used to maneuver through narrow spaces such as aisles for stores, hallways, or other areas that are tight.

The radius of rotation for mobility devices can range between 31 inches and 72 inches, based on the model. It is also important to know that you may need make use of a tape measure to determine how far the scooter will turn in these tight spaces.

Mobility Devices with a Short Turn Radius

A mobility device with an extremely short turn radius can allow the user to move in and out of tight spaces quickly and easily. This allows for easier maneuvering in kitchens, bathrooms, and other public areas.

The turning radius is an important feature to take into consideration when choosing the right mobility device, whether it's a scooter, electric wheelchair or reclining chair. This is because it determines the amount of space it takes to make a 180 degree turn.

This could be as little as 20" for the power chair. For motorized devices and scooters the height can be as high as 40 inches.

This is a crucial aspect because it will greatly impact the ease with driving your mobility device, particularly when you're driving around tight corners. It also helps you avoid hitting furniture and objects.

A reliable mobility device that has a the ability to turn quickly will also have advanced braking systems. These include hydraulic disc brakes, electromagnetic brakes, and automated braking systems. These kinds of brake systems are more effective and safer than manual brakes.

The ground clearance of mobility aids is also important. If you intend to drive your mobility device through rough terrain, such as dirt, grass or sand, or thick carpets and carpets, you should choose a device that has a higher ground clearance.

A high clearance on the ground is also important when you're using your device in public areas where a lower ground clearance might lead to slipping or sliding. If you're a wheelchair user who frequently navigates in narrow, limited areas, this feature is even more essential. You should also check if the mobility device you pick comes with an anti-tipping feature that will stop it from tipping over.
